Junior CAD / Drafting Technician (Edmonton, AB)

ROLE
Surerus Murphy Joint Venture is recruiting for a competent, enthusiastic, and dynamic Junior CAD / Drafting Technician to join our team supporting ongoing energy infrastructure construction projects across Canada & USA. This role reports to both the Digital Design Lead, as well as project-based engineering & construction teams. A Junior CAD / Drafting Technician works with project teams to prepare engineering design and construction drawings, process survey information, create & develop 3D models, and output construction models for machine control files.

SMJV places engineering at the forefront of all our infrastructure construction projects. Applicants with the drive to succeed, a strong work ethic and always seek to improve are encouraged to apply. Pipeline (or similar) experience is preferred but additional training will be provided for suitable candidates new to the energy infrastructure industry.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Opportunity to work on high-profile, large-scale energy projects of national importance, including oil & gas pipelines, net-zero energy projects & renewable energy projects.
  • Use the latest Autodesk CAD software to prepare project design & construction 3D models and drawings.
  • Create large earthworks & grading models for export into site equipment for machine control & calculation of material volumes.
  • Utilize UAV LIDAR & photogrammetry data, laser scan pointcloud data sets and orthographic imagery for incorporation into, and development of, 3D construction models.
  • Responsible to produce project construction facilitation drawings, including access route plans & road upgrade drawings, site & equipment layouts, trenchless pipeline crossings, open cut pipeline crossings, environmental mitigation drawings, lift plan drawings, steep slope identification & construction drawings.
  • Work in different geographic coordinate systems with metric, imperial and mixed metric units.
  • Produce project models & drawings in accordance with the company CAD Standard, ensuring that drawings are prepared, stored, issued, and archived in accordance with current company procedures.
  • Project data management of all CAD files.
  • Follow checking and self-checking process, issuing drawings to internal and external clients, and managing electronic information.
  • Solve technical challenges, maintain and improve knowledge of drafting techniques, task workflows, standards, and engineering procedures.

POSITION REQUIREMENTS
Qualifications
  • Completion of high school diploma is required.
  • Graduate from an accredited college program in Civil Engineering Technology, Design Engineering Technology, CAD Technology, or from a career college in Engineering CAD / BIM Technology.
Experience
  • 1-year minimum previous experience in a similar role.
  • Field experience is an asset.
Skills and Knowledge
  • Excellent Autodesk AutoCAD skills.
  • Basic Autodesk Civil 3D skills & knowledge – ideally completion of recognized Civil 3D Essentials course as a minimum.
  • Genuine interest in drafting and digital engineering & construction technology practices, processes and workflows.
  • Strong and professional verbal and written communication.
  • Competence in the use of Autodesk Infraworks, Navisworks, and/or ReCap would be an advantage.
  • Strong understanding of pipeline construction, design, techniques, and equipment is an asset.
  • Understanding of pipeline crossing designs & techniques – HDB, HDD, and Augerbore crossing design is an asset.
  • Knowledge of the design & construction of utility scale solar farm projects would be an asset.

WORKING CONDITIONS
This is a permanent position based at our Spruce Grove office with a 5-day work week, 8-hour days .

P roject schedules will typically follow 6 days on 1 day off shift, working 12 hours per day with a site based daily pay uplift. There will be a requirement to be site based when placed to work on a construction project. Project sites are usually based in areas throughout Alberta and British Columbia.
